  • Rebecca Kohler, PA-C is a certified Physician Assistant and works in Bariatric and General Surgery at University of Utah Health. She is also the Director of Advanced Practice for the Department of Surgery. She holds a Master’s Degree in Physician Assistant Studies from the University of Utah and completed her undergraduate degree at Alma College in Michigan. As a part of her undergraduate education, she studied abroad in both Mexico and Spain and speaks fluent Spanish. She has worked for the University of Utah Hospital since 2007. In her current role in the division of General Surgery, she is involved the care of bariatric and general surgery patients. Her involvement includes pre-surgical evaluation and education, nutrient deficiency monitoring, pre and post-operative care, and post-surgical follow-up. She is also a member of the surgical team and first assists in the operating room. Ms. Kohler's research interests include H. pylori, vitamin deficiencies and nutrition. She was the recipient of the University of Utah Department of Surgery APC Excellence Award in Administration in 2021.
